The Honors Program offers travel funds to support current honors students to conduct research, present scholarly work at regional or national conferences (not including NCUR*), or carry out creative work.
Conference travel awards are available for IC Honors students to present their research and creative products/projects at professional conferences. Priority is given to those who are presenting, but students who wish to attend a conference can also request funds.
Funds are available to support travel for undergraduates who conduct research or creative works in close collaboration with an Ithaca College mentor or who undertake self-directed research/creative endeavors under the supervision of an IC mentor.
Applications will be reviewed on a rolling basis.
